Impact Assessment of the Response Measures to Local Epidemics Induced by the Agents of Particularly Dangerous Infections: Isolation

Abstract

The paper discusses the opportunities of using universal model of local, evolving within a closed population, epidemics/outbreaks, developed at the premises of SRC VB “Vector”, for investigations and assessment of the impact of various resource limitations on the countermeasure effectiveness, and in particular isolation of a patient and contact tracing and isolation. Based on the epidemic dynamics analysis for a number of infections such as smallpox, anthrax, pneumonic and bubonic plague, hemorrhagic Ebola, Marburg, Lassa, Crimean-Congo fevers, it is demonstrated that occurrence of resource limitations of isolation can have a significant impact on the scale of epidemic aftermaths. Moreover, the outset of response measures takes a severe effect, as one of the important for localization of arthropod-borne infection factors is quarantine, alongside with isolation. The computer based software model is available at http://vector-epimod.ru
